| CVE-2002-1046 | 1 Watchguard | 2 Firebox, Soho Firewall |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| Dynamic VPN Configuration Protocol service (DVCP) in Watchguard Firebox firmware 5.x.x all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via a malformed packet containing tab characters to TCP port 4110. | ||||
| CVE-2002-1520 | 2 Rapidstream, Watchguard | 2 Rapidstream, Firebox |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| The CLI interface for WatchGuard Firebox Vclass 3.2 and earlier, and RSSA Appliance 3.0.2, does not properly close the SSH connection when a -N option is provided during authentication, which allows remote attackers to access CLI with administrator privileges. | ||||
| CVE-2001-0204 | 1 Watchguard | 1 Firebox Ii |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| Watchguard Firebox II all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service by establishing multiple connections and sending malformed PPTP packets. | ||||
| CVE-2000-1182 | 1 Watchguard | 1 Firebox Ii |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| WatchGuard Firebox II all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service by flooding the Firebox with a large number of FTP or SMTP requests, which disables proxy handling. | ||||
| CVE-2001-0692 | 1 Watchguard | 2 Firebox 2500, Firebox 4500 |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| SMTP proxy in WatchGuard Firebox (2500 and 4500) 4.5 and 4.6 allows a remote attacker to bypass firewall filtering via a base64 MIME encoded email attachment whose boundary name ends in two dashes. | ||||
| CVE-2024-5974 | 1 Watchguard | 51 Firebox M200, Firebox M270, Firebox M290 and 48 more | 2025-01-13 | 7.2 High |
| A buffer overflow in WatchGuard Fireware OS could may allow an authenticated remote attacker with privileged management access to execute arbitrary code with system privileges on the firewall. This issue affects Fireware OS: from 11.9.6 through 12.10.3. | ||||
| CVE-2022-25361 | 1 Watchguard | 47 Firebox M200, Firebox M270, Firebox M290 and 44 more | 2024-11-21 | 9.1 Critical |
| WatchGuard Firebox and XTM appliances allow an unauthenticated remote attacker to delete arbitrary files from a limited set of directories on the system. This vulnerability impacts Fireware OS before 12.7.2_U2, 12.x before 12.1.3_U8, and 12.2.x through 12.5.x before 12.5.9_U2. | ||||
